Effective, low-odour, and long-lasting — a solid alternative to wood or rocky litter
This is an incredibly functional litter that clumps well and makes cleaning up much easier. It’s great at hiding smells, and I’ve found it lasts longer than some others because the clumps are easy to scoop without needing to change the entire tray.The litter size is somewhere between woodchip and rocky types — fine enough to clump but not so dusty that it kicks up much when disturbed. It does get a little powdery over time, but noticeably less so than wood-based litter.It’s marketed as eco-friendly thanks to being corn-based, though I can’t personally vouch for the sourcing. Still, it feels like a step in the right direction compared to clay-based litters.The bag is durable and holds up well during storage and refills. That said, I’d prefer it to be paper-based like some other brands — it would better align with the eco credentials.Overall, a practical, reliable choice for cat owners looking for an unscented, clumping litter that balances performance with lower dust and solid odour control.

Sticks to their paws!
Using this maize/corn litter while we rehabilitate four rescues before they venture into the great outdoors, and after using it a while have decided to review.Giving this product three to four stars. Here’s why:Four stars: Once the poos have been removed (essential) it is very easy to dispose of the used litter which is a real bonus. Either green recycling or waste bin or compost heap, which is really helpful and so much better than clay litter.Clumps well, is lightweight and easy to remove from tray although we use a wallpaper scraper to get the heavily-sodden lumps off the bottom of the tray as with four cats using two trays there’s a lot of wee.Can hardly detect any odour which is impressive. Obviously the poos give off the standard delightful hum, but once these are flushed down the loo and the litter refreshed there is truly hardly any smell at all. Apparently you can also flush the used litter as it disintegrates - not been brave enough to do that yet though - thoughts of a costly plumber spring to mind. Perhaps I should put some fresh litter in a glass and see what happens….anyway…Now for the three star bit and bear in mind this may not apply if you have only one or two cats: the litter sticks to their paws something chronic so every morning we have a major clean-up job of vacuuming and wiping down anywhere they have been - window sill for example. Bits of litter get everywhere and as it gets used in the tray can become powdery, stick to their paws and then there are little dusty paw prints all over the carpets. That is the only downside but it is time consuming to clear it all up each day.As an aside, the cats are happy to use the litter no problem.Hope this review helps!

Litter tray smells awful
This is the worst litter I tried. I read all the good reviews when I decided to buy it and honestly and don’t get how anyone can like this litter. Since the litter is made out of corn it has naturally earthy corn scent to it which you can definitely smell around the litter tray. After two weeks of using this litter it smelled awfully in the house of dirty litter tray even though we scoop out the trays daily. The litter become weird wet sand consistency a bit like in children’s sand pits and the clumps didn’t hold together. The ammonia smell is really bad. I think the clumps essentially fall apart which means the urine is not removed and that’s why the smell builds up. I have tried so many litters in the past and that’s by far the worst I tried so far
